Modello Black Porcelain Cobble Setts

Modello Black Porcelain Cobbles are a deep black colour which is sure to bring a stylish and modern new vibe to your outdoor space.

Whether being used for paving, edging or for driveways, Modello Black is the perfect way to create a unique and eye catching space which will stand out from your neighbours.

Italian Porcelain is incredibly popular due to it’s high-quality, durability and beautiful craftsmanship. Upgrade your outdoor space today.

Porcelain Paving is perfect for those who’d like to lay their patio and simply give it a clean once or twice a year (or as necessary).

The edges of porcelain are perfectly made to measure and there will be little or no variance between each of the slabs. The surface is smooth but manufactured to R11 anti-slip standards so will still be perfectly suitable for foot traffic in winter.

Modello Black Porcelain Specifications

Modello Black Porcelain Specifications

  • Size: 20cm x 10cm x 20mm
  • Sawn Edges: The edges of these slabs have been finished by machine so they are perfectly smooth. A great choice for a clean finish
  • Surface Finish: The surface is ‘naturally smooth’, so there is no need to worry about excessive flaking, or rough/sharp patches of the stone occurring
  • Colour Palette: A deep black colour with subtle natural stone markings

Modello Black Porcelain Cobble FAQ's

Modello Black Porcelain Cobble FAQ's

What is a Modello Black Porcelain Cobble?

Cobbles, in the sense that we sell them, are small 10x10cm or 20x10cm blocks of stone that are thicker than paving slabs. In general, they are used as edging for patio’s or or driveways, but they also look good when used over a larger area.

What is a Sett?

A sett is an alternative name for a cobble. They are often used interchangeably but in our case, we normally refer to them as cobbles.

How is a Modello Black Porcelain Cobble typically used?

Cobbles are an incredibly versatile type of stone. Due to their small size and relative thickness, they are suitable for driveways, large patio areas or as a special feature within a patio. However, most commonly they are used to edge a finished patio or driveway to make the project look fully finished.

Do patios need a cobbled edge?

They do not. Cobbles serve no constructional purpose when used as edgings, so there is no requirement to edge a new patio with a cobbled border, however the majority of people prefer an edged finished. As with a lot of elements of landscaping, this is all personal preference.

Are Modello Black Porcelain Cobbles suitable for driveways?

Yes. The most important element of a driveway is the foundation and thickness of your material. Cobbles are small and thick in comparison to paving slabs, so the weight of a car is well spread over multiple cobbles, with very little chance of the product failing. Cobbled driveways are increasingly popular.
